How they compare

Central Asia currently reports 6.11 kt against 3.83 kt in Kazakhstan, a difference of 2.28 kt.

That makes Central Asia's figure about 1.6 times Kazakhstan's.

Across all 34 years both countries report, Central Asia has been ahead every year.

Central Asia ranks 28th and Kazakhstan ranks 30th of 32 groups.

Central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
